What does anti-HCV indicate?

Q: I am a 37 years old male diagnosed with anti-hepatitis C virus (HCV). The patient value is 2.125 and cut off value is 0.366. What does anti-HCV indicate?

A:Anti HCV just informs us that you have been exposed to the Hepatitis C virus. It does not tell us whether or not you currently have the infection at all, or an acute infection or even a chronic infection. Please see your doctor, more investigations may be required and some treatment suggestions made depending upon your current medical condition.
